Phase diagram of CdO–V2O5–In2O3 system

Description

Highlights: •A new compound with the formula Cd3In4V6O24 has been obtained as a result of a solid-state reaction. •Thermal properties of Cd3In4V6O24 has been established. •The subsolidus phase relations of the ternary system CdO–V2O5–In2O3 were investigated. -- Abstract: The subsolidus phase equilibria of the ternary system CdO–V2O5–In2O3 were investigated by differential thermal analysis (DTA) and X-ray diffraction technique (XRD). It has been shown that the system consists of ten subsidiary systems in which three solid phases coexist in equilibrium in each subsystem. CdV2O6 and In2O3-were proved to react in the solid phase and at the molar ratio of 3:2 and the formation of a new compound Cd3In4V6O24 was observed. This new compound undergoes incongruent melting at 920 °C with deposition of solid In2O3. Cd3In4V6O24 crystallises in the monoclinic system with elementary cell parameters of a = 0.8793(1) nm, b = 1.578(1) nm, c = 0.7506(7) nm, γ = 96.6°, Z = 2
